Buying Guide: How To Choose A PS4 Keyboard

  • Platform compatibility: Ensure the keyboard is confirmed to work with PS4 via USB. If you plan to also use it with PC, check for multi-device support or driverless operation to minimize setup steps.
  • Layout and size: Tenkeyless (TKL) or compact 87-key options save desk space and improve mouse maneuverability, which is beneficial for console couch setups. Full-size boards provide dedicated number pads that some users prefer for productivity.
  • Switch type and feel: Mechanical-feel membranes are common, offering crisp keystrokes and durability at a lower price than true mechanical switches. For some, genuine mechanical switches offer superior tactile feedback and a longer lifespan.
  • Backlighting: RGB or single-color backlighting can aid in low-light gaming sessions and help with key visibility during PS4 gameplay. Look for adjustable brightness and mode options such as static, breathing, or cycling.
  • Connectivity: Wired keyboards deliver the lowest latency—ideal for competitive play—while wireless keyboards offer flexibility in living room setups. Some models provide Bluetooth or 2.4 GHz options with multi‑device pairing.
  • Durability and longevity: Consider anti-ghosting or n-key rollover for simultaneous keystrokes. Water resistance or spill resistance may be valuable for casual, living-room use where beverages are nearby.
  • Additional features: Media controls, macro support, and hot-swappability (for switches) can add value for gaming and productivity tasks. Macro support may require software that may not be fully compatible with all PS4 titles.
